psifi kits run 17 psi i believe, however they have a piggyback unit that is wired into the ecu and allows the boost to be so high. they have a 2.8 inch pully. i have a 3.0, however i have not installed it yet, either this week or next when i have some time at home....... hoping to see around 14-15, with the bypass mod, however i dont know if the boost guage will actually show it......
